Sun and moon are perhaps the most important symbols in all the major civilizations in Latin America - the Mayas, Aztecs, and also Olmecs. All the temples, the palaces and major constructions have them in one form or the other. There are records of kings dedicating entire cities to the Sun god and huge palaces to the moon.
This picture is not from any of the archeological sites, but is a front door a small house in downtown Tlaxcala. Even my apartment's door has a golden yellow sun hanging on the side.
